Action item: The Relayn deploy-status bot silently dropped updates when the pipeline API paginated results, so responders believed a rollback had completed when it had not. We will add pagination handling, a staleness banner, and an integration test. Until merged, verify deploy state directly in the pipeline console, documented at the page below.

runbook for kahop-kajop: https://rundeck.ordinio.test/display/secrets/pipeline/issue/pages/repo/browse/e5732776e07d1285107e5aeb

Runbook: Localizing date formats in Plumeria plugins. Plugin authors must never hard-code date patterns; always resolve them through the LocaleBridge API so regional overrides apply consistently. Before testing, confirm your sandbox matches the host's locale settings, including fallback chain and first-day-of-week handling. Mismatches here cause subtle rendering bugs that pass unit tests. Verify your environment against the reference locale configuration, reproduced below.

settings of yahaf-tahop:
jorox:
  pin: 5851
  tenant: noveth
  seal: seal_7ddb5c42
  metrics_host: metrics.jorox.ordinnet.example
  standby_team: wenax
  escalation: oliath-feneth
  nonce: 552548

Ticket: Staging env misconfigured for Siftgate bloom filter

The bloom layer in front of the Pellet KV store is rejecting all lookups in staging because the env file was copied from the dev template without credentials. False-positive tuning values are fine; only the auth line is missing. To unblock the weekly demo, the Pellet admission secret must be set on the following line.

env line for yaguf-fajop: LEDGER_TOKEN13=fb08984397349